Django:针对远程LDAP用户进行身份验证 - 简单示例?

AP2*_*257 15 django ldap

我正在使用django_auth_ldap - 我们有一个现有的用户数据库,以及一个与我已有的用户数据库共享用户名的外部LDAP系统.

我真的可以用一个简单的例子来说明

  • 获取用户的本地名称(他们已登录到Windows LDAP系统 - 我能以某种方式从浏览器中获取用户名吗?)
  • 对远程Windows LDAP服务器进行身份验证
  • 在Django模板中使用它(只显示名称就可以了)

任何人都可以提供(希望)几行代码,以获得如何执行此操作的简单示例吗?

谢谢!

Chr*_*ing 0

您是否正在尝试为您的 MS Windows 用户提供一些单点登录解决方案?

然后你会在http://docs.djangoproject.com/en/dev/howto/auth-remote-user/中找到你需要的所有提示